Snowflake and Palantir Partner on Native Integration to Speed Agentic AI

The tie-up routes Palantir apps to governed Snowflake data without duplication.

Overview

  • Snowflake announced a formal partnership with Palantir to connect the Snowflake AI Data Cloud with Palantir Foundry and AIP through a native integration.
  • The companies say the setup reduces data silos and latency by enabling secure, high‑volume communication without moving sensitive records.
  • Benzinga reports the plan includes enhanced Foundry integration with Snowflake Iceberg Tables to provide bidirectional, zero‑copy data access.
  • Eaton is cited as a customer using the pairing to build an AI‑ready data foundation and accelerate deployment of AI agents, according to Benzinga.
  • Snowflake describes the disclosure as an initial step with no specifics on availability, pricing, or rollout, while its shares rose in Thursday trading.
